STATISTICS ON ORDERED PARTITIONS OF SETS AND q-STIRLING NUMBERS
An ordered partition of [n] := {1, 2, . . . , n} is a sequence of its disjoint subsets whose union is [n]. The number of ordered partitions of [n] with k blocks is k!S(n, k), where S(n, k) is the Stirling number of second kind. متن کاملEuler-Mahonian statistics on ordered set partitions (II)
We study statistics on ordered set partitions whose generating functions are related to p, q-Stirling numbers of the second kind. The main purpose of this paper is to provide bijective proofs of all the conjectures of Steingŕımsson(Arxiv:math.CO/0605670).
